Central Garden & Pet Co is a leading U.S.-headquartered supplier of pet supplies and garden products. Its portfolio includes pet food, treats, grooming tools, lawn care items, gardening accessories and pest control solutions, serving retail partners like mass merchants, independent pet stores and garden centers across North America with multiple well-known consumer brands in its two core segments.
Legence Corp is a leading sustainable building and decarbonization solution provider. It delivers energy efficiency optimization, building automation design, renewable energy integration, and low-carbon retrofit services for commercial, industrial, and institutional clients, with core operations across North America to help customers cut costs and reduce carbon footprints.
